TUBERCULOSIS

on BBC Home Service Basic

An exposure of ' the treacherous disease ' and its continuing menace by J. S. CAMPBELL
The latest tuberculosis registers for the United Kingdom contain 377,757 cases under observation. In spite of great advances in treatment over the past fifteen years, the tubercle bacillus is far from beaten.
